How It Works

Slot machines use a random number generator (RNG), which generates numbers at random to ensure fair play and equal odds for all players. These numbers determine the payback percentage for a given game, which is based on the probability that each symbol lines up.

Some games even have special bonus rounds, which add another level of complexity to the game. While these bonuses can increase your chances of winning, RTP and volatility still are more important predictors of your overall winning streak.

Don’t chase your losses

A common mistake players make is to continue betting on a slot that is losing, hoping to see their bankroll grow. This is a hugely risky strategy, as it will only hurt your bankroll in the long run.
